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ad Ingredients
• Elevate your summer meals with this delightful recipe!
For the Pasta
- Bowtie Pasta – Offers an appealing shape and holds dressing well; feel free to use rotini or penne for a twist.
For the Salad
- Strawberries – Provides sweetness and a refreshing bite; ripe, hulled strawberries are essential for flavor.
- Baby Spinach – Adds a tender, earthy flavor; arugula makes a good peppery alternative if desired.
- Red Grapes – Gives a juicy crunch; swap with green grapes for a different taste.
- Red Onion – Supplies color and a slight sharpness; sweet onion can help tone down the bite if preferred.
- Mandarin Oranges – Infuses a citrusy sweetness; canned segments are convenient and flavorful.
- Feta Cheese – Introduces a salty contrast to the fruits; goat cheese or cheddar cubes are great alternatives.
- Poppy Seed Dressing – Ties all the flavors together; Bitten Lemon flavor is recommended for a zesty touch.
- Pecans – Adds crunch and depth; walnuts or slivered almonds work beautifully too.
- Salt & Pepper – Essential for seasoning to taste; adjust according to your preference.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
Begin by bringing a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il over high heat. Add the bowtie pasta and cook according to the package instructions—usually about 8-10 minutes—until it’s al dente and tender yet firm to the bite. Once cooked, drain the pasta in a colander and rinse it under cold water to stop the cooking process. Set aside to cool completely.
Step 2: Prepare the Salad Ingredients
While the pasta cools, take a large mixing bowl and combine the vibrant ingredients: hulled strawberries, juicy red grapes, finely diced red onion, and fresh baby spinach. Don’t forget to add canned mandarin oranges for a sweet citrus kick and creamy feta cheese, which adds a lovely salty contrast. Gently mix everything together in the bowl until well combined, creating a colorful medley.
Step 3: Combine Pasta and Salad
Once the pasta is fully cooled, add it to the large bowl of prepared salad ingredients. Toss everything together gently but thoroughly, ensuring the pasta is evenly distributed among the strawberries, vegetables, and cheese. The visual appeal of your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ad will begin to shine through as the colors blend beautifully.
Step 4: Dress the Salad
Drizzle a generous amount of poppy seed dressing over the combined ingredients in the bowl. Season with salt and pepper to your taste—don’t hold back, as this step enhances all the flavors. Using a large wooden spoon or spatula, carefully toss the salad again, making sure all ingredients are coated in the dressing for a deliciously balanced flavor in each bite.
Step 5: Chill the Salad
C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id and place it in the refrigerator to chill for at least 30 minutes. This crucial step allows the flavors of the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ad to meld beautifully, enhancing the overall taste as it cools. If you have time, letting it chill longer—up to a couple of hours—will yield even better results.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
After chilling, give the salad a final gentle toss. Ta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ary. Serve the refreshing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ad in a large serving bowl, making sure to scoop out the vibrant mix of ingredients. Expert Tips for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ad
- Chill Time Matters: Allow the salad to chill for at least 30 minutes before serving. This enhances flavors as they meld together beautifully.
- Dress Lightly: Start with a small amount of poppy seed dressing and add more to taste, preventing the salad from becoming overly soggy.
- Use Fresh Ingredients: Always opt for fresh, ripe strawberries and spinach for the best flavor and texture in your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ad.
- Texture Control: Mix gently to avoid crushing the strawberries and feta, keeping the salad visually appealing and texturally delightful.
- Add Protein: For a heartier option, consider adding grilled chicken or chickpeas, making this salad a satisfying main dish.
Make Ahead Options
These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ad is perfect for meal prep enthusiasts! You can cook the bowtie pasta and refrigerate it for up to 3 days in advance to save time. Additionally, you can also chop and mix all the fresh ingredients—strawberries, grapes, spinach, and onion—and store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. To maintain the quality, avoid adding the dressing until you’re ready to serve; this prevents sogginess. When you’re set to enjoy the salad, simply combine the prepped ingredients, drizzle with dressing, and give it a toss. You’ll have a delicious, refreshing dish with minimal effort!
Storage Tips for Strawberry Fields Pasta Salad
-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4 days. It’s best enjoyed fresh, but keeping it chilled will maintain its vibrant flavors.
- Freezer: Avoid freezing the salad, as this can compromise the texture of fresh ingredients, particularly strawberries and feta.
- Reheating: If you prefer a warm salad, simply let it come to room temperature. However, enjoy it chilled for the best experience!
- Serving: Before serving any leftovers, give the salad a gentle toss and check seasoning; you may want to add a splash more dressing for flavor renewal.
